EP1632852A3 - Architecture pour l'extension des applications intelligentes - Google Patents

Architecture pour l'extension des applications intelligentes Download PDF

Info

Publication number
EP1632852A3
EP1632852A3 EP05108007A EP05108007A EP1632852A3 EP 1632852 A3 EP1632852 A3 EP 1632852A3 EP 05108007 A EP05108007 A EP 05108007A EP 05108007 A EP05108007 A EP 05108007A EP 1632852 A3 EP1632852 A3 EP 1632852A3
Authority
EP
European Patent Office
Prior art keywords
application
data
add
smart client
base
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Withdrawn
Application number
EP05108007A
Other languages
German (de)
English (en)
Other versions
EP1632852A2 (fr
Inventor
Mohammad Mushtaque Silat
Viswanath Vadlamani
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Microsoft Corp
Original Assignee
Microsoft Corp
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Microsoft Corp filed Critical Microsoft Corp
Publication of EP1632852A2 publication Critical patent/EP1632852A2/fr
Publication of EP1632852A3 publication Critical patent/EP1632852A3/fr
Withdrawn legal-status Critical Current

Links

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for program control, e.g. control units
    • G06F9/06Arrangements for program control, e.g. control units using stored programs, i.e. using an internal store of processing equipment to receive or retain programs
    • G06F9/46Multiprogramming arrangements
    • G06F9/54Interprogram communication
    • G06F9/547Remote procedure calls [RPC]; Web services
    • G06F9/548Object oriented; Remote method invocation [RMI]
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for program control, e.g. control units
    • G06F9/06Arrangements for program control, e.g. control units using stored programs, i.e. using an internal store of processing equipment to receive or retain programs
    • G06F9/46Multiprogramming arrangements
    • G06F9/54Interprogram communication
    • G06F9/546Message passing systems or structures, e.g. queues
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06QINFORMATION AND COMMUNICATION TECHNOLOGY [ICT] S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L OR SUPERVISORY PURPOSES; SYSTEMS OR METHODS S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L OR SUPERVISORY PURPOSES, NOT OTHERWISE PROVIDED FOR
    • G06Q10/00Administration; Management
    • G06Q10/10Office automation; Time management

Landscapes

  • Engineering & Computer Science (AREA)
  • Theoretical Computer Science (AREA)
  • Software Systems (AREA)
  • Physics & Mathematics (AREA)
  • General Physics & Mathematics (AREA)
  • Business, Economics & Management (AREA)
  • Strategic Management (AREA)
  • General Engineering & Computer Science (AREA)
  • Entrepreneurship & Innovation (AREA)
  • Human Resources & Organizations (AREA)
  • Tourism & Hospitality (AREA)
  • Economics (AREA)
  • General Business, Economics & Management (AREA)
  • Quality & Reliability (AREA)
  • Operations Research (AREA)
  • Data Mining & Analysis (AREA)
  • Marketing (AREA)
  • Information Retrieval, Db Structures And Fs Structures Therefor (AREA)
  • Information Transfer Between Computers (AREA)
  • Management, Administration, Business Operations System, And Electronic Commerce (AREA)
  • Mobile Radio Communication Systems (AREA)
EP05108007A 2004-09-03 2005-09-01 Architecture pour l'extension des applications intelligentes Withdrawn EP1632852A3 (fr)

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
US10/934,524 US20060080468A1 (en) 2004-09-03 2004-09-03 Smart client add-in architecture

Publications (2)

Publication Number Publication Date
EP1632852A2 EP1632852A2 (fr) 2006-03-08
EP1632852A3 true EP1632852A3 (fr) 2006-06-21

Family

ID=35501050

Family Applications (1)

Application Number Title Priority Date Filing Date
EP05108007A Withdrawn EP1632852A3 (fr) 2004-09-03 2005-09-01 Architecture pour l'extension des applications intelligentes

Country Status (4)

Country Link
US (1) US20060080468A1 (fr)
EP (1) EP1632852A3 (fr)
JP (1) JP2006099760A (fr)
CN (1) CN1744121B (fr)

Families Citing this family (55)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US7707255B2 (en) 2003-07-01 2010-04-27 Microsoft Corporation Automatic grouping of electronic mail
US20060015361A1 (en) * 2004-07-16 2006-01-19 Jurgen Sattler Method and system for customer contact reporting
US8255828B2 (en) 2004-08-16 2012-08-28 Microsoft Corporation Command user interface for displaying selectable software functionality controls
US7703036B2 (en) 2004-08-16 2010-04-20 Microsoft Corporation User interface for displaying selectable software functionality controls that are relevant to a selected object
US8146016B2 (en) 2004-08-16 2012-03-27 Microsoft Corporation User interface for displaying a gallery of formatting options applicable to a selected object
US7934018B1 (en) * 2004-09-30 2011-04-26 Emc Corporation Methods and apparatus for synchronizing configuration data
JP5112613B2 (ja) * 2004-10-15 2013-01-09 エスアーペー アーゲー 活動管理システム及び方法、活動管理装置、クライアント端末、ならびに、コンピュータプログラム
US7734686B2 (en) * 2005-01-25 2010-06-08 International Business Machines Corporation Markup method for managing rich client code and experiences using multi-component pages
US8239882B2 (en) 2005-08-30 2012-08-07 Microsoft Corporation Markup based extensibility for user interfaces
US8627222B2 (en) 2005-09-12 2014-01-07 Microsoft Corporation Expanded search and find user interface
US7599861B2 (en) 2006-03-02 2009-10-06 Convergys Customer Management Group, Inc. System and method for closed loop decisionmaking in an automated care system
US8379830B1 (en) 2006-05-22 2013-02-19 Convergys Customer Management Delaware Llc System and method for automated customer service with contingent live interaction
US7809663B1 (en) 2006-05-22 2010-10-05 Convergys Cmg Utah, Inc. System and method for supporting the utilization of machine language
US9727989B2 (en) 2006-06-01 2017-08-08 Microsoft Technology Licensing, Llc Modifying and formatting a chart using pictorially provided chart elements
US7530079B2 (en) * 2006-09-07 2009-05-05 Microsoft Corporation Managing application customization
US8850388B2 (en) * 2006-09-07 2014-09-30 Microsoft Corporation Controlling application features
US7908580B2 (en) 2006-09-07 2011-03-15 Microsoft Corporation Connecting an integrated development environment with an application instance
US8150798B2 (en) 2006-10-10 2012-04-03 Wells Fargo Bank, N.A. Method and system for automated coordination and organization of electronic communications in enterprises
US20080133681A1 (en) * 2006-10-13 2008-06-05 Jackson Troy V System and method for diagnosis of and recommendations for remote processor system
US20080201759A1 (en) * 2007-02-15 2008-08-21 Microsoft Corporation Version-resilience between a managed environment and a security policy
US8336043B2 (en) 2007-02-15 2012-12-18 Microsoft Corporation Dynamic deployment of custom code
US8060892B2 (en) 2007-04-27 2011-11-15 Microsoft Corporation Executing business logic extensions on a client computing system
US8352553B2 (en) * 2007-04-30 2013-01-08 Microsoft Corporation Electronic mail connector
US7895246B2 (en) * 2007-05-31 2011-02-22 Microsoft Corporation Collection bin for data management and transformation
US8762880B2 (en) 2007-06-29 2014-06-24 Microsoft Corporation Exposing non-authoring features through document status information in an out-space user interface
US8484578B2 (en) 2007-06-29 2013-07-09 Microsoft Corporation Communication between a document editor in-space user interface and a document editor out-space user interface
US20090037829A1 (en) * 2007-08-01 2009-02-05 Microsoft Corporation Framework to integrate web services with on-premise software
US20090217254A1 (en) * 2008-02-22 2009-08-27 Microsoft Corporation Application level smart tags
US7991740B2 (en) * 2008-03-04 2011-08-02 Apple Inc. Synchronization server process
US9588781B2 (en) 2008-03-31 2017-03-07 Microsoft Technology Licensing, Llc Associating command surfaces with multiple active components
US20090307233A1 (en) * 2008-06-02 2009-12-10 Guorui Zhang Efficient Handling of PMU Data for Wide Area Power System Monitoring and Visualization
US9298684B2 (en) * 2008-06-18 2016-03-29 Microsoft Technology Licensing, Llc Implementing custom user interface forms in a personal information manager
US9665850B2 (en) 2008-06-20 2017-05-30 Microsoft Technology Licensing, Llc Synchronized conversation-centric message list and message reading pane
GB2463028A (en) * 2008-08-28 2010-03-03 Cr Systems Ltd A method of operating an offline mobile sales service logistics system
CN101431742B (zh) * 2008-12-24 2010-06-16 ***通信集团北京有限公司 一种通信业务的接入方法及***
US20100250322A1 (en) * 2009-03-27 2010-09-30 Michael Roy Norwood Simplified user interface and method for computerized task management systems
US8799353B2 (en) 2009-03-30 2014-08-05 Josef Larsson Scope-based extensibility for control surfaces
US20110138335A1 (en) * 2009-12-08 2011-06-09 Sybase, Inc. Thin analytics for enterprise mobile users
US8302014B2 (en) * 2010-06-11 2012-10-30 Microsoft Corporation Merging modifications to user interface components while preserving user customizations
US9390399B2 (en) 2010-06-22 2016-07-12 Microsoft Technology Licensing, Llc Integrating a web-based CRM system with a PIM client application
US8756254B2 (en) * 2010-12-09 2014-06-17 Microsoft Corporation Integration of CRM applications to ECS application user interface
US8775554B2 (en) 2010-12-30 2014-07-08 Microsoft Corporation Cloud-based web page applications for extending functionality
US9049174B2 (en) 2011-08-09 2015-06-02 Mobileframe, Llc Maintaining sessions in a smart thin client server
US9053444B2 (en) 2011-08-09 2015-06-09 Mobileframe, Llc Deploying applications in a smart thin client server
US20130042312A1 (en) * 2011-08-09 2013-02-14 Mobileframe Llc Authentication in a smart thin client server
US10599620B2 (en) * 2011-09-01 2020-03-24 Full Circle Insights, Inc. Method and system for object synchronization in CRM systems
US10621206B2 (en) * 2012-04-19 2020-04-14 Full Circle Insights, Inc. Method and system for recording responses in a CRM system
US9059894B2 (en) * 2011-09-02 2015-06-16 Accenture Global Services Limited Data exchange technology
US9310888B2 (en) 2012-03-16 2016-04-12 Microsoft Technology Licensing, Llc Multimodal layout and rendering
US20140108091A1 (en) * 2012-04-19 2014-04-17 FullCircle CRM Method and System for Attributing Metrics in a CRM System
US9569356B1 (en) * 2012-06-15 2017-02-14 Emc Corporation Methods for updating reference count and shared objects in a concurrent system
US20140081903A1 (en) * 2012-09-17 2014-03-20 Salesforce.Com, Inc. Methods and systems for displaying and filtering business analytics data stored in the cloud
US10764081B2 (en) * 2014-07-28 2020-09-01 Vivint, Inc. Asynchronous communications using home automation system
US10025758B2 (en) 2015-04-27 2018-07-17 Microsoft Technology Licensing, Llc Support for non-native file types in web application environment
CN107809517B (zh) * 2016-09-08 2020-07-10 阿里巴巴集团控股有限公司 事件展示方法及装置

Citations (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
WO2001033430A1 (fr) * 1999-10-29 2001-05-10 Contact Networks, Inc. Procede et systeme de mise a jour des renseignements utilisateur geres par un autre systeme utilisateur
US20010056422A1 (en) * 2000-02-16 2001-12-27 Benedict Charles C. Database access system
EP1237098A1 (fr) * 1999-10-14 2002-09-04 Sap Ag Système intégré de bases de données fédérées

Family Cites Families (11)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5999938A (en) * 1997-01-31 1999-12-07 Microsoft Corporation System and method for creating a new data structure in memory populated with data from an existing data structure
US6636873B1 (en) * 2000-04-17 2003-10-21 Oracle International Corporation Methods and systems for synchronization of mobile devices with a remote database
US6993522B2 (en) * 2001-06-27 2006-01-31 Microsoft Corporation System and method for resolving conflicts detected during a synchronization session
JP2003122885A (ja) * 2001-10-17 2003-04-25 Seiko Epson Corp 営業活動支援システムとコンピュータプログラム
WO2003102778A2 (fr) * 2002-05-31 2003-12-11 International Business Machines Corporation Systeme et procede d'acces a differents types de stockages de donnees de dorsal
US7277940B2 (en) * 2002-08-29 2007-10-02 Sap Ag Managing uneven authorizations in a computer data exchange
CN100356333C (zh) * 2002-12-27 2007-12-19 清华大学 基于网络的应用程序协同工作、决策***及其实现方法
US20050222931A1 (en) * 2003-08-27 2005-10-06 Ascential Software Corporation Real time data integration services for financial information data integration
US7814470B2 (en) * 2003-08-27 2010-10-12 International Business Machines Corporation Multiple service bindings for a real time data integration service
WO2005022417A2 (fr) * 2003-08-27 2005-03-10 Ascential Software Corporation Procedes et systemes pour des services d'integration en temps reel
US20050198085A1 (en) * 2003-10-10 2005-09-08 Accenture Global Services Gmbh Tool for synchronization of business information

Patent Citations (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
EP1237098A1 (fr) * 1999-10-14 2002-09-04 Sap Ag Système intégré de bases de données fédérées
WO2001033430A1 (fr) * 1999-10-29 2001-05-10 Contact Networks, Inc. Procede et systeme de mise a jour des renseignements utilisateur geres par un autre systeme utilisateur
US20010056422A1 (en) * 2000-02-16 2001-12-27 Benedict Charles C. Database access system

Non-Patent Citations (1)

* Cited by examiner, † Cited by third party
Title
ANONYMOUS: "SIEBEL SYSTEMS AND MICROSOFT DELIVER INTEGRATED INNOVATION; SIEBEL 7.7 RELEASE UTILIZES MICROSOFT .NET", INTERNET ARTICLE, 21 April 2004 (2004-04-21), XP002374164, Retrieved from the Internet <URL:http://www.microsoft.com/presspass/press/2004/apr04/04-21msseibelintegrationpr.mspx> [retrieved on 20060324] *

Also Published As

Publication number Publication date
EP1632852A2 (fr) 2006-03-08
CN1744121A (zh) 2006-03-08
CN1744121B (zh) 2012-08-22
US20060080468A1 (en) 2006-04-13
JP2006099760A (ja) 2006-04-13

Similar Documents

Publication Publication Date Title
EP1632852A3 (fr) Architecture pour l&#39;extension des applications intelligentes
WO2005119493A3 (fr) Gestionnaire d&#39;applications virtuelles
CN105528694A (zh) 基于集群通讯的企业互联办公***
US8392512B2 (en) Method and system for managing a shared electronic mail account
US20070083602A1 (en) Method, system and software for dynamically extracting content for integration with electronic mail
WO2001095585A3 (fr) Systeme de serveur de file d&#39;attente de messages
CA2420145A1 (fr) Systeme et procede pour faire passer d&#39;un systeme hote a un appareil de communication de donnees mobile des messages d&#39;evenement d&#39;agenda
WO2007064994A1 (fr) Acces distant en lecture-ecriture a des stockages de donnees disparates
EP1376399A3 (fr) Système et procédé servant d&#39;interface API entre XML et SQL pendant l&#39;interaction avec un environnement contrôlé d&#39;objets
EP1643424A3 (fr) Publication contextuelle des actions
WO2009115921A2 (fr) Technique de mobilisation des ressources d&#39;entreprise
US20070124376A1 (en) Messaging Architecture
CN101460940A (zh) 使用联系人列表自动订阅整合馈源
PL364157A1 (en) Method of data transmission between sever and customer
SE9904697D0 (sv) Kösystem
CN101895579A (zh) 通讯录同步方法和***
EP1655923A3 (fr) Système et procédé pour la provision de qualité de service dans une bouble locale
NO20031868D0 (no) Server for å mappe applikasjonsnavn til TAG-verdier for en distribuert flerbrukerapplikasjon
CN111694495A (zh) 一种快速对接第三方app平台的方法、***和存储介质
EP1065618A3 (fr) Système de flux de travail avec la possibilité de définir des transactions commerciales
CA2358726A1 (fr) Methode, systeme et logiciel pour la commande de biens et/ou de services sur un reseau de communication
CN108234280A (zh) 一种支持企业协同办公的即时通信***
WO2005033894A3 (fr) Systemes et procedes de gestion de ressources
EP1315108A3 (fr) Appareil et logiciel pour la protection des informations d&#39;attributs personnels
EP1638006A3 (fr) Systeme de service des lecteurs des cartes électroniques et procédé de service des lecteurs des cartes électroniques

Legal Events

Date Code Title Description
PUAI Public reference made under article 153(3) epc to a published international application that has entered the european phase

Free format text: ORIGINAL CODE: 0009012

AK Designated contracting states

Kind code of ref document: A2

Designated state(s): A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HU IE IS IT LI LT LU LV MC NL PL PT RO SE SI SK TR

AX Request for extension of the european patent

Extension state: AL BA HR MK YU

PUAL Search report despatched

Free format text: ORIGINAL CODE: 0009013

RIC1 Information provided on ipc code assigned before grant

Ipc: G06F 9/46 20060101ALI20060509BHEP

Ipc: G06F 9/445 20060101AFI20060110BHEP

AK Designated contracting states

Kind code of ref document: A3

Designated state(s): A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HU IE IS IT LI LT LU LV MC NL PL PT RO SE SI SK TR

AX Request for extension of the european patent

Extension state: AL BA HR MK YU

17P Request for examination filed

Effective date: 20061207

17Q First examination report despatched

Effective date: 20070110

AKX Designation fees paid

Designated state(s): A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HU IE IS IT LI LT LU LV MC NL PL PT RO SE SI SK TR

STAA Information on the status of an ep patent application or granted ep patent

Free format text: STATUS: THE APPLICATION IS DEEMED TO BE WITHDRAWN

18D Application deemed to be withdrawn

Effective date: 20120726